Telangana Rains - Streams, tanks overflow in erstwhile Khammam
In Akeru, a cow washed away while crossing the Tirthala bridge due to flooding. Because of the overflowing Katteleru stream in ap, traffic between andhra pradesh and telangana was interrupted.
Vehicle traffic between Yellandu and kothagudem in kothagudem came to a complete stop for a while due to a tree that fell on the major road close to Tekulapally. Due to the severe rain, flood water was already entering the Kinnerasani reservoir in Paloncha. Two reservoir gates will be opened at 10 p.m. on tuesday in order to discharge 8,000 cusecs of extra water downstream, according to officials. They sent a notice to the locals in the communities' downstream area.
Due to the district's expected severe rain over the next three days, district collector Dr. priyanka Ala warned both the general public and district authorities to exercise caution. Officials at the village, mandal, and district levels have been directed to be accessible at their places of employment.
She advised against crossing overflowing streams and advised against using overflowing bridges for traffic. The collector said, "NDRF teams were available for emergency services, and the general public should call the control rooms in case of any emergency."
Up to 10 mandals in the district had moderate to heavy rainfall, and 12 mandals experienced just light to moderate rainfall. Rain had an impact on the output of coal in the opencast mines owned by SCCL in kothagudem, Yellandu, and Manugur.
